An Optimal Register resource Allocation Algorithm using Graph Coloring

  • Park, Ji-young (Dept. of Electronic Engineering, Chongju University) ;
  • Lim, Chi-ho (Dept. of Computer Science, Semyung University) ;
  • Kim, Hi-seok (Dept. of Electronic Engineering, Chongju University)
  • Published : 2000.07.01

Abstract

This paper proposed an optimal register resource allocation algorithm using graph coloring for minimal register at high level synthesis. The proposed algorithm constructed interference graph consist of the intermediated representation CFG to description VHDL. and at interference graph fur the minimal select color selected a position node at stack, the next inserted spill code and the graph coloring process executes for optimal register allocation. The proposed algorithm proves to effect that result compare another allocation techniques through experiments of bench mark.

Keywords